- Know the Signs That It’s Time for a Roof Repair or Replacement
Before jumping into a roofing project, it’s important to identify whether your roof truly needs a full replacement or just repairs.
In Salt Lake City, the combination of heavy snow, strong winds, and summer heat can take a toll on roofing materials. Common signs of damage include:
- Curling or missing shingles
- Granule loss (tiny sand-like particles in your gutters)
- Water stains on ceilings or walls
- Sagging areas on the roof deck
- Moss or mold growth
If you notice any of these issues, don’t wait until the next storm hits , early intervention can save you thousands in future repairs.
- Choose the Right Roofing Material for Utah’s Climate
Salt Lake City’s climate is unique: cold, snowy winters and hot, dry summers. Choosing the right roofing material can make all the difference in longevity and performance. Here are some popular options:
Asphalt Shingles
Affordable and versatile, asphalt shingles are a top choice for Salt Lake City homes. They perform well in changing temperatures and are available in many styles and colors.
Metal Roofing
Metal roofs reflect heat, handle snow loads efficiently, and can last 40–70 years. While the upfront cost is higher, the long-term savings in maintenance and energy efficiency make them a great option.
Tile Roofing
Clay and concrete tiles add durability and a distinct aesthetic, perfect for Utah’s upscale homes. However, they require a strong structure due to their weight.
Composite or Synthetic Roofing
Modern synthetic materials mimic slate or wood but are lighter and more weather-resistant , ideal for homeowners looking for both beauty and practicality.
Choosing the right material isn’t just about looks; it’s about balancing cost, performance, and longevity in Utah’s unpredictable weather.

- Don’t Overlook Ventilation and Insulation
Many homeowners focus on shingles and materials but overlook the importance of ventilation and insulation. Proper airflow prevents heat buildup in the summer and ice dams in the winter , two common problems in Salt Lake City homes.
An experienced roofing company will inspect your attic, check vents, and make sure your roofing system performs efficiently year-round. Investing in this part of the project can significantly extend the life of your roof and reduce energy costs.

- Plan Your Budget Wisely
Roofing costs vary depending on materials, roof size, and project complexity. On average, a new roof in Salt Lake City can range from $8,000 to $20,000, but the right contractor will help you balance affordability and quality.
To stay within budget:
- Request multiple quotes
- Understand what’s included (tear-off, cleanup, permits)
- Avoid “too good to be true” deals
- Consider financing options for large projects

- Timing Your Project: When’s the Best Season for Roofing in Salt Lake City?
Timing matters more than most people realize. The best seasons for roofing in Salt Lake City are typically spring through early fall, when weather conditions are stable.
However, if you experience storm damage or leaks, don’t wait; emergency repairs can be done safely year-round by professional crews equipped for Utah’s climate.
